Extrusion molding is a process in which a material such as plastic or metal is pushed through a die to create a particular shape. The material is heated until it’s soft and then pushed through the die by a machine called an extruder. The die is akin to a mold that forms the material as it moves through. As the material cools, it retains the shape of the die and forming a final product.

Extrusion molding typically makes use of plastics. Stuff like polyethylene (all the plastic bags, and most packing foam) PVC (the stuff water pipes are made of) and ABS (lego) is popular because it is easy to melt and form. Metals such as aluminum and steel can also be extruded, but the process required higher temperatures and more pressure.
